MDEV-13564: Refuse MLOG_TRUNCATE in mariabackup
The MySQL 5.7 TRUNCATE TABLE is inherently incompatible with hot backup, because it is creating and deleting a separate log file, and it is not writing redo log for all changes of the InnoDB data dictionary tables. Refuse to create a corrupted backup if the unsafe form of TRUNCATE was executed. Note: Undo log tablespace truncation cannot be detected easily. Also it is incompatible with backup, for similar reasons. xtrabackup_backup_func(): "Subscribe to" the log events before the first invocation of xtrabackup_copy_logfile(). recv_parse_or_apply_log_rec_body(): If the function pointer log_truncate is set, invoke it to report MLOG_TRUNCATE.
